Krishna Playing the Flute with Gopikas — Hand-painted Pichwai
This luminous Pichwai portrays Krishna under the full moon, playing his flute as gopikas gather around in devotion. Delicate lotuses, temple lamps and rhythmic symmetry turn this artwork into a hymn of divine harmony.

Symbolism and Craft
Each detail celebrates joy and love — the essence of radha-krishna pichwai art. Hand-painted by artisans of Nathdwara, it brings movement and serenity to any interior.
